>> non-consecutive axes?  I am not aware of that term.  I probably know
>> what you mean, but not by that name...
>
> It's a term I just made up.  I mean machines with multiple axes from 
> the
> list "XYZABCUVW" but with gaps.  For example, lathes have axes "XZ", 
> so
> the missing Y makes X and Z non-consecutive.
>
> Try running the sim/axis/lathe config on joints_axes to see the error
> i'm talking about.

OK.  This makes sense.  It seems strange that that would trigger an 
error, and I agree that would be a show stopper in the master branch.
